Latest Trends
The Rise of Sustainability in CO Production and UtilizationSustainable Production Technologies
Companies are actively researching and developing cleaner and more efficient methods for CO production, exploring alternatives to traditional fossil fuel-based processes, utilizing renewable energy sources, and minimizing waste generation.Carbon Capture and Utilization (CCUS)
The development of CCUS technologies is opening up new avenues for CO2 emissions reduction in CO production, leading to the potential for a more circular and sustainable approach.Green Chemistry Applications
The growing interest in green chemistry is driving the development of new applications for CO, focusing on its use as a raw material for the production of bio-based chemicals, renewable polymers, and sustainable materials.Drivers
A Convergence of Environmental Concerns and Technological AdvancementsEnvironmental Regulations
The tightening of environmental regulations is driving the demand for cleaner and more sustainable CO production processes, prompting companies to adopt innovative technologies and to explore alternative feedstocks.Green Chemistry Initiatives
Government incentives and industry initiatives promoting green chemistry are fostering the development of new CO-based products and technologies that prioritize sustainability and environmental responsibility.Emerging Applications
The exploration of new applications for CO, particularly in areas like renewable energy production, green polymers, and advanced materials, is opening up new market opportunities and driving further innovation in CO research and development.Challenges
Overcoming Obstacles to Sustainable GrowthCost-Effectiveness
The development and implementation of sustainable CO production and utilization technologies can be capital-intensive, requiring significant investments to overcome the initial high costs associated with these advancements.Safety Concerns
The inherent flammability and toxicity of CO pose challenges for safe handling, transportation, and storage, requiring robust safety protocols and advanced technologies to mitigate risks.Public Perception
The perception of CO as a hazardous chemical, due to its toxicity and historical association with certain polluting industrial processes, can hinder its wider adoption and market penetration.Competitive Landscape
A Focus on Innovation and SustainabilityThe carbon monoxide market is characterized by a mix of established players, including chemical producers, industrial gas suppliers, and technology developers, alongside emerging startups focused on innovative and sustainable CO utilization pathways.
